| In DARKEST OF DAYS , you'll get to experience some of the most varied gameplay ever released in one title. Things will never get stale as you travel to distant times and fight alongside people from that time period. Fighting in Antietam (the bloodiest day of the American Civil War) feels much different than fighting on the side of the Russians at Tannenberg (where the Russians withstood 140,000 casualties in WWI).Fight in FIVE different Time Periods Whether its in Pompeii, Antietam, WWI, WWII, or Little Big Horn you will fight with real weapons from the time period. You will battle against enemies that fight in different ways, all reflective of how fighting was done at the time. |

- You will fight against the Confederates (and the Union at times), facing a staggering number of troops, all fighting in unison. Ready, aim...steady men...FIRE!
- You will jump from the trenches in WWI to lead an attack against the Huns. You will fire artillery to hit distant targets. You will defend to the last man!
- You will fight in Pompeii, while Mt. Vesuvius is spewing ash and fire into the atmosphere. You will fight amongst a frightened population, fleeing for their lives.
- Play From Opposing Sides Of Conflicts Nearly every time period offers game play from each side of the conflict. In trying to keep history pure, you have to undo mistakes you make, which may require fighting from the other perspective to "mend"
- Unleash Hell With Futuristic WeaponryWhat could you have done with an automatic rifle during the Civil War, or some futuristic laser sighted pulse cannon in the trenches of WW I? There are times where you have no other choice but to bust out the big guns.
